A bicycle tire whose volume is 4.1 x 10-4 m3 has a temperature of 283 K and an absolute pressure of 3.31 x 105 Pa. A cyclist brings the pressure up to 7.19 x 105 Pa without changing the temperature or volume. How many moles of air must be pumped into the tire?
